What if the opposite of addiction isn't sobriety, but connection? Scott Davis, Chief Clinical Officer at Valiant Living, opens up about this profound truth and much more in our latest episode, sharing wisdom gained from years of guiding men through recovery.

With vulnerable honesty, Scott addresses how we can find peace during tumultuous times by seeking authentic connection rather than isolation. "The best thing you can do is limit your social media," he advises, suggesting instead that we reach for human connection that transcends political divisions and touches something deeper – our shared humanity.

The conversation takes a fascinating turn as Scott reveals the transformative power of group therapy. For many men entering recovery, the thought of sharing their deepest struggles in a group setting triggers intense fear. Yet Scott demonstrates how this very vulnerability creates the healing environment so many desperately need. "If it's in your head, it's a dangerous place," he explains, highlighting how bringing thoughts into the open – whether through writing or sharing with trusted others – creates clarity and relief.

Perhaps most powerful is Scott's exploration of shame, which he calls "terminally shameful" rather than "terminally unique." The shame that makes us feel fundamentally flawed and isolated becomes, ironically, the very thing that can connect us when shared in a safe group setting. "When somebody shares their pain with you, it is a sacred thing," Scott reflects, describing the "tragic beauty" of witnessing others' vulnerability and recognizing our shared struggles.

Scott also unpacks how individual therapy works alongside group therapy at Valiant, preparing clients to bring their deepest wounds into a community where deeper healing happens. Even conflict within groups becomes an opportunity for growth, often reflecting unresolved family-of-origin issues that can finally be addressed in a supportive environment.
